About This Book
Soft puffing sounds fill the quiet night as Thomas the Tank Engine chugs along the tracks. The cool night air whispers as he searches for his friends, hoping they're tucked in and dreaming. Will everyone be asleep when Thomas arrives?

Quick Assessment
This early reader book features Thomas the Tank Engine as he looks for his sleepy friends, using alternating acetate pages to engage young readers visually and tactilely. Designed for ages 5-8, it combines simple concepts with gentle bedtime themes, making it suitable for early readers and ideal as a calming bedtime story.
Why we rated Peep, peep, are you asleep? 5C
Peep, peep, are you asleep? is written at a Level K-1 reading level across 9 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 1.5 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Peep, peep, are you asleep? works for readers up to grade 2.5.
We rate Peep, peep, are you asleep? as 5C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.
Thematically, Peep, peep, are you asleep? explores bedtime & dreams, friendship, concepts, and juvenile fiction —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
